Who you are:

  • You have a strong technical or scientific background. For life sciences, preference for candidates with advanced degrees. For technical backgrounds, preference for electrical engineering, computer science, mechanical engineering or closely related field.
  • You have 3-4 years of patent litigation experience.
  • You have an active membership in the state bar and compliance with CLE requirements
  • You have superior writing skills and excellent academic credentials.
  • You thrive when using your analytical skills to conduct complex and detailed analysis of legal matters.
  • You enjoy communicating with a diverse group of clients, attorneys, and staff.
  • You are enthusiastic about working within a team-oriented environment and will contribute to effective team relationships.

The salary for this position is $260,000 – $310,000. The salary offered will depend upon qualifications and experience, and will be adjusted for flex-time schedules.
